event.srcElement 可以捕获当前事件作用的对象,如event.srcElement.tagName可以捕获活动标记名称。...event.srcElement.TagName //事件对象的html标记 event.srcElement.value //表单事件对象的值 第一个子标签为 event.srcElement.firstChild...最后个一个是 event.srcElement.lastChild 当然也可以用 event.srcElement.children[i] event.srcElement.ChildNode...下的 event.target = IE 下的 event.srcElement 解决方法:使用obj(obj = event.srcElement ?...event.srcElement : event.target;)来代替IE下的event.srcElement或者Firefox下的event.target.
click(); } function handleEvent2(event) { var target = event.target || event.srcElement
在IE下,event对象有srcElement属性,但是没有target属性;Firefox下,even对象有target属性,但是没有srcElement属性.。 ...解决方法:使用obj(obj = event.srcElement ?...event.srcElement : event.target;)来代替IE下的event.srcElement或者Firefox下的event.target.。...:使用obj(obj = event.srcElement ?...event.srcElement : event.target;)来代替IE下的event.srcElement或者Firefox下的event.target.
document.oncontextmenu =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.onpaste =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...屏蔽复制 document.oncopy =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...屏蔽剪切 document.oncut =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.onselectstart =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ement
document.oncontextmenu =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.onpaste =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.oncopy =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.oncut =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.onselectstart =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ement
document.oncontextmenu =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...屏蔽粘贴 document.onpaste = function (event){ event = window.event; }try{ var the = event.srcElement...document.oncopy =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.oncut =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ement...document.onselectstart = function (event){ if(window.event){ event = window.event; }try{ var the = event.srcElement
event = window.event; } try { var the = event.srcElement...(window.event) { event = window.event; } try { var the = event.srcElement...event) { if (window.event) { event = window.event; } try { var the = event.srcElement...(window.event) { event = window.event; } try { var the = event.srcElement...event) { if (window.event) { event = window.event; } try { var the = event.srcElement
document.getElementById("t1").addEventListener("click", e => { alert("第一次点击会隐藏,此后再也无法点击"); e.srcElement.classList.add...").addEventListener("click", e => { alert("第一次点击会透明,依旧占据原本位置,点击事件依旧有效,动画过渡效果生效"); e.srcElement.classList.add...t6").addEventListener("click", e => { alert("第一次点击会隐藏,元素不占据原本位置,点击事件不再生效,过渡动画有效"); e.srcElement.classList.add...t3").addEventListener("click", e => { alert("第一次点击会隐藏,依旧占据原本位置,点击事件不再生效"); e.srcElement.classList.add...t4").addEventListener("click", e => { alert("第一次点击会隐藏,元素不占据原本位置,过渡动画有效"); e.srcElement.classList.add
window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ement...event = window.event; } try { var the = event.srcElement
window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ement...window.event) { event = window.event; } try { var the = event.srcElement
/a> {% endfor %} 大概就是这样子的 通过data自定义属性为a标签绑定上不好获取的值,每一次循环都是不同的值,我们通过event来判断点击的是哪次循环 然后在通过event事件里面的srcElement.dataset...ref_test($event){ // 通过event 事件获取当前元素的data中绑定的值 var n1=$event.srcElement.dataset.d1...var n2=$event.srcElement.dataset.d2 var n3=$event.srcElement.dataset.d3...// var n4=$event.srcElement.dataset.d4 // 需要获取上一个input里面的值 ,这个方法行不通了...currentTarget.previousElementSibling 的意思表示为获取当前标签的上一个标签 var n5=$event.srcElement.dataset.d5
function linkClickHandler(event) { // alert(event.srcElement...+"is event.srcElement"); // alert(event.target+"is event.target"); var t =event.srcElement...+= t.id+" click "; } function linkDownHandler(event) { // alert(event.srcElement...+"ddddddddis event.srcElement"); // alert(event.target+"is event.target"); var...t =event.srcElement||event.target; // alert(t.id+" qq1 "); sss2.innerHTML +=
document.ondragstart = function() { return false }; // 禁止选择文本 document.onselectstart = function() { if (event.srcElement.type...= "text" && event.srcElement.type != "textarea" && event.srcElement.type !...document.ondragstart = function() { return false }; // 禁止选择文本 document.onselectstart = function() { if (event.srcElement.type...= "text" && event.srcElement.type != "textarea" && event.srcElement.type !
="img01" onerror="slnotimg();"/>function slnotimg() {var img = event.srcElement...= "img02";img.onerror = null;} 代码测试 测试图存在,测试图正常显示 function slnotimg() { var img = event.srcElement.../files/icon/load.svg"; img.onerror = null; } 测试图不存在,自动替换显示加载图 function slnotimg() { var img = event.srcElement
document.createElement('div') div.style.border = 'solid 1px' div.style.position = 'absolute' if(event.srcElement... = event.clientX div.style.top = event.clientY }else{ div.style.left = ao(event.srcElement.parentElement..., true) + 20 + 'px' div.style.top = ao(event.srcElement.parentElement, false) + 20 + 'px'
> 2、怎么获取当前右键点击时的tab 通过查看 e.srcElement.id... :name="item.id" 就是tab的id值,只要获取当前右键点击时的tab的id值就知道当前的tab openContextMenu(e) { //console.log(e.srcElement...); if (e.srcElement.id) { let currentContextTabId = e.srcElement.id.split("-")[1];
在查找事件的来源元素时,chrome有 srcElement 属性, 火狐却没有 srcElement 属性,必须用target。 ...srcElement返回的是一个Element对象,但是target返回一个Node。 不过编程时,好像是互用的。
事件有srcElement,可以获取到刚插入的dom节点。 这里开始简单粗暴的做正则匹配,匹配所有url。 再逐个比较是否白名单域名,如果不是,则判定为劫持。...(e.srcElement.outerHTML || e.srcElement.wholeText) : $('html').html(); var reg = /http:\/\/([...e.srcElement : document.documentElement; if (!
img :src="item.imageUrl" class="" @error="imgError" />JavaScript代码: imgError(e) { e.srcElement.src...= require("图片地址"); },可能出现的问题碎片图标反复闪烁 imgError(e) { e.srcElement.src = require("图片地址");...e.srcElement.onerror=null; },
领取专属 10元无门槛券
手把手带您无忧上云